Introduction to Machine Perfusion in Liver Transplants

Machine perfusion (MP) is emerging as a pivotal technology in organ transplantation, specifically for enhancing donor liver viability. This technique involves maintaining donated livers in a functioning state outside the body by mimicking normal physiological conditions. The primary goal is to improve organ quality and extend the viability period, thereby increasing the success rates of liver transplants.

Understanding the Basics of Liver Machine Perfusion

Machine perfusion in liver transplantation operates by supplying the liver with oxygenated blood or a specialized perfusate. This process helps in reducing ischemic injury and preserving cellular function. The technique can be categorized into two main types: hypothermic and normothermic perfusion, each with distinct mechanisms and benefits for organ preservation.

Benefits of Normothermic Machine Perfusion

Normothermic machine perfusion (NMP) maintains the liver at body temperature, allowing it to function normally by producing bile. This method is particularly beneficial for assessing organ viability and repairing marginal livers, which might otherwise be deemed unsuitable for transplantation. NMP has shown promising results in improving transplant outcomes and reducing graft dysfunction.

Exploring Hypothermic Perfusion's Role

Hypothermic machine perfusion (HMP) involves cooling the liver to slow its metabolic rate, which minimizes cellular damage during preservation. HMP is effective in extending the preservation time of donor livers, making it a valuable option for managing logistical challenges in organ transplantation. Research indicates that HMP can significantly reduce the incidence of biliary complications post-transplant.

Comparative Analysis of MP Techniques

While both NMP and HMP offer significant advantages, choosing the appropriate method depends on specific donor and recipient circumstances. Studies suggest that NMP might be superior in maintaining liver function and assessing viability, whereas HMP is favored for its simplicity and cost-effectiveness in extending preservation times of donor livers.

Impact of Machine Perfusion on Transplant Surgery

Integrating machine perfusion into clinical practice has revolutionized liver transplant surgeries. By improving the quality of donor livers, MP reduces the risk of early graft failure and enhances patient outcomes. This technology also expands the donor pool by rehabilitating organs that would not meet the criteria for transplantation under static cold storage methods.

Machine Perfusion and Donor Liver Assessment

One of the critical advantages of machine perfusion is the ability to assess the functional status of the liver before transplantation. This assessment is crucial for predicting post-transplant liver function and helps in making informed decisions regarding the use of marginal livers, thus potentially reducing waiting times for liver transplant recipients.

Technological Advances in Liver Machine Perfusion

The field of liver machine perfusion is witnessing rapid technological advancements aimed at automating and optimizing the perfusion process. Innovations include real-time monitoring systems that assess liver function and detect potential issues during the perfusion process, thereby enhancing the safety and efficacy of liver transplantation.

Challenges and Limitations of Machine Perfusion

Despite its benefits, machine perfusion faces several challenges, including high costs, technical complexities, and the need for specialized training for healthcare providers. Moreover, the long-term impacts of MP on patient survival and graft longevity are still under investigation, necessitating ongoing research and development in this field.
